Green Facade Restoration: Environmentally-Friendly Choices

Modern facade restoration initiatives are increasingly prioritizing environmentally sound techniques. Instead of full replacement , consideration is given to upgrading existing components with new materials . Examples include utilizing reused cladding, applying low-emissivity glazing , and integrating green walls . These strategies not only reduce damage but also improve facade's energy efficiency and aesthetic attractiveness .

Facade Refurbishment: Common Problems and Solutions

Addressing difficulties during facade refurbishment scheme often occurs due to various reasons. Usually, water damage is a significant problem, stemming from failing sealant, damaged pointing, or missing coping details. Another frequent concern is spalling of the brickwork , caused by freeze-thaw cycles or faulty repairs. In addition, rusting of steel features , like railings , can impact the facade's structural soundness. Solutions necessitate thorough inspection, followed by precise repairs. These may include renewing sealant and pointing, repacking joints, applying anti-weathering coatings, repairing spalled areas, and treating corroded metal. The restoration contractor should also assess using compatible materials to provide long-term performance.

  • Water Ingress: Replace cracked sealant, repoint joints.
  • Masonry Spalling: Apply protective coatings, patch damaged areas.
  • Metal Corrosion: Clean corroded metal, repair affected components.
